Job description

Overview:

The HR Administrator plays a key role in supporting operational teams with all aspects of HR. This position is responsible for managing onboarding processes, maintaining employee records, coordinating office functions, and ensuring compliance with federal and state employment regulations. The role requires str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to collaborate effectively across departments.

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Conduct in-person interviews and assist with candidate selection.
  • Collaborate closely with the recruitment team to support hiring initiatives.
  • Complete all onboarding steps and ensure compliance with FCS, state, and federal requirements for new hires.
  • Order uniforms and supplies for operational staff.
  • Coordinate/conduct orientation and on-the-job training (OJT) with the operations team.
  • Oversee daily office operations and administrative functions.
  • Serve as a liaison with the corporate HR team.
  • Support management with employee discipline.
  • Track and report employee hires, terminations, and employment changes.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date employee personnel files.
  • Support and promote employee engagement initiatives.
  • Deliver items to client locations as needed.
  • Ensure state and federal labor law posters are current and properly displayed.
  • Perform additional duties as needed to support office and operational teams.
Qualifications
  • Education: High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Experience: Human Resources or Administrative Assistant.
Skills
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Teams).
  • Strong organizational and communication skills.
  • Ability to multitask and manage time effectively.
Work Environment
  • Standard office setting with occasional travel to client locations.
  • Physical demands include:
    • Sitting for extended periods while working at a computer.
    • Walking within the office to access equipment and files.
    • Reaching, lifting, bending, and handling documents and office tools.
    • Speaking and listening to interact with employees and clients.
